Discover Ludwig"would have submitted" is grammatically correct and can be used in written English.
This phrase is an example of the conditional perfect tense, which is used to express an action that would have happened in the past if certain conditions were met. Example: If I had known about the deadline, I would have submitted my assignment on time.
